Kwara State Governor Appoints Prof. Shuaib Oba Abdulraheem to Lead the Charge for a State University of Education

In a significant move towards advancing education in Kwara State,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q has taken a decisive step by appointing a prominent figure to spearhead the establishment of the Kwara State University of Education. The former Vice Chancellor of the University of Ilorin, Prof. Shuaib Oba Abdulraheem (OFR), has been named as the chairman of the study, planning, and implementation committee for this pivotal project.

The 11-member committee includes Deacon Pastor Afolayan J. Babatunde as the Secretary, along with distinguished individuals such as Professor (Mrs) Medinat Salman, Prof. (Mrs) Sidikat F. Adeyemi, Prof. Umar Gunu, Engineer Sa’ad Belgore, Mrs. Mulikat Lawal, Femi Aina, former Special Adviser on Special Duties Alhaji Abubakar Abdul-Razaq Jiddah, and representatives from the Ministries of Housing and Urban Development and Justice, the latter being a female member.

This bold initiative is set to leverage one of the existing Colleges of Education as the launchpad for the new University of Education. Simultaneously, the state is working towards having one of the Colleges of Education adopted as a Federal College of Education in Abuja, while another College will operate in dual-mode, enabling it to confer bachelor’s degrees in accordance with recent legislation governing Colleges of Education in Nigeria.

The primary responsibility of the 11-member committee is to meticulously design the framework for the university's establishment, functionality, and financial sustainability. They will also be tasked with developing a strong case for the necessity of a state-owned specialized university of education. This includes assessing the existing conventional colleges or universities that offer non-degree programs (NCE/Diploma) and ensuring they meet the criteria for automatic registration with the Teachers’ Registration Council.

This strategic move is poised to transform the educational landscape in Kwara State and enhance the quality of teacher education. It signifies a significant step forward in advancing the state's commitment to providing quality education to its citizens.
